To calculate a foot value to the corresponding value in inch, just multiply the quantity in foot by 12 (the conversion factor). Here is the formula:

Value in inches = value in foot × 12

Suppose you want to convert 549 foot into inches. Using the conversion formula above, you will get:

Value in inch = 549 × 12 = 6588 inches

Definition of Inch

An inch is a unit of length or distance in a number of systems of measurement, including in the US Customary Units and British Imperial Units. One inch is defined as 1⁄12 of a foot and is therefore 1⁄36 of a yard. According to the modern definition, one inch is equal to 25.4 mm exactly.
